linux访问url,linux系统中打开网站

大家好,今天小编来为大家解答linux访问url这个问题,linux系统中打开网站很多人还不知道,现在让我们一起来看看吧!

linux以url访问tcp

在Linux系统中,通过URL访问TCP并不是直接通过Web浏览器的方式访问TCP端口的服务,而是通过配置服务器或使用特定的工具来实现。例如,可以使用Nginx或Apache等服务器软件配置反向代理,将HTTP请求转换为TCP连接,从而实现通过URL访问TCP服务的效果。此外,还可以使用Telnet或Netcat等工具直接建立TCP连接。

详细解释:

1.通过服务器软件配置反向代理:Linux上的服务器软件如Nginx或Apache可以配置为反向代理服务器。这意味着它们可以接收来自Web浏览器的HTTP请求,并将这些请求转换为TCP连接。一旦配置完成,用户可以通过访问特定的URL来触发TCP连接,从而访问后端服务。这种方式常用于Web应用中对后端服务的访问控制。

2.使用Telnet建立TCP连接:Telnet是一个用于远程登录或远程管理的网络协议,它基于TCP协议工作。在Linux系统中,可以使用Telnet客户端工具直接建立TCP连接。虽然这不是通过URL直接访问,但它是通过命令行界面实现TCP连接的一种常见方式。

3.使用Netcat:Netcat是一个用于处理TCP和UDP连接的命令行工具。它允许用户创建TCP连接并发送和接收数据。尽管Netcat不能直接通过URL使用,但它是一个灵活的工具,可用于各种网络相关的任务,包括通过TCP协议进行通信。

总的来说,Linux系统中以URL访问TCP并不是直接通过浏览器进行的,而是通过服务器配置或命令行工具来实现TCP连接的建立和管理。这些技术为Linux用户提供了灵活的选项,以适应不同的网络应用场景。

以上信息是基于现有的Linux网络配置和工具的解释,随着技术的不断进步,可能会有新的方法和工具出现,因此建议查阅最新的技术文档和指南以获取最新信息。

linux怎么打开网址

linux系统下命令行访问网页是curl命令。

Curl(CommandLineUniformResourceLocator),在命令行中利用URL进行数据或者文件传输。直接在curl命令后加上网址,就可以看到网页源码。

具体分析一下这个命令语法的用法:

1.基础用法

语法

lynx(选项)(参数)

选项

-case:在搜索字符串时,区分大小写;

-ftp:关闭ftp功能;

-nobrowse:关闭目录浏览功能;

-noclor:关闭色彩显示模式;

-reload:更新代理服务器的缓存,只对首页有效;

--color:如果系统支持彩色模式,则激活彩色模式;

--help:显示指令的帮助信息;

2.内部命令

移动命令

下方向键:页面上的下一个链接(用高亮度显示)。

上方向键:页面上的前一个链接(用高亮度显示)。

回车和右方向键:跳转到链接指向的地址。

左方向键:回到上一个页面。

滚动命令

+、Page-Down、Space、Ctrl+f:向下翻页。

-、Page-Up、b、Ctrl+b:向上翻页。

Ctrl+a:移动到当前页的最前面。

Ctrl+e:移动到当前页的最后面。

Ctrl+n:向下翻两行。

Ctrl+p:往回翻两行。

):向下翻半页。

(:往回翻半页。

#:回到当前页的 Toolbar或 Banner。

想了解更多有关如何使用linux命令打开网页的详情,推荐咨询达内教育。达内教育致力于面向IT互联网行业,培养软件开发工程师、测试工程师、UI设计师、网络营销工程师、会计等职场人才,目前已在北上海广深等70个大中城市成立了342家学习中心;拥有行业内完善的教研团队,强大的师资力量,200余位总监级讲师,1000余名教研人员,确保学员利益,全方位保障学员学习;更是与多家企业签订人才培养协议,全面助力学员更好就业。感兴趣的话点击此处,免费学习一下

linux 以URL访问TCP

在Linux的socket编程中,一个常见的操作是通过URL来访问TCP服务。无需预先设定路径,程序员可以直接利用gethostbyname这个网络信息函数来解析URL中的域名,这个函数会查找系统中的/etc/hosts文件或者DNS服务,以确定域名与其对应的IP地址。然而,gethostbyname并不直接返回IP地址,而是返回一个hostent结构,这个结构在后续的connect调用中扮演关键角色。

URL中的参数部分,包括路径和查询参数,通常会被包含在HTTP请求的头部,也就是"HTTP请求首部"中。因此,Linux socket编程中,开发者主要关注的是通过gethostbyname获取域名对应的IP地址,然后构建完整的HTTP请求头,即可进行TCP连接的建立。

总之,在Linux的socket编程中,处理URL的核心步骤是获取域名的IP地址和构造HTTP请求头部,这对于与远程服务器进行通信至关重要。一旦这些基础操作完成,就可以有效地实现TCP访问。

阅读剩余
THE END